Understanding Emergency Room Error Claims
In the high-pressure environment of an emergency room (ER), medical errors can occur due to a variety of complex factors, from miscommunication among healthcare professionals to equipment malfunctions or misdiagnoses. When these errors result in harm to a patient, understanding the claims process is crucial for both patients and their advocates, such as an emergency room error lawyer. Documenting incidents meticulously is paramount; accurate records serve as the bedrock for any subsequent legal action, ensuring that the specifics of what transpired can be reconstructed clearly.
An experienced personal injury attorney specializing in ER errors can guide patients through this intricate process, helping them navigate contract disputes and gather evidence to support their cases. These lawyers leverage their expertise to ensure that all relevant documentation is properly collected and utilized, including medical records, witness statements, and any available surveillance footage or digital data from the facility. This comprehensive approach is essential for achieving justice and compensation for patients who have suffered due to avoidable medical mistakes.
The Importance of Comprehensive Documentation
Comprehensive documentation plays a pivotal role in emergency room (ER) error claims, serving as a crucial tool for both patients and their legal representatives, such as an emergency room error lawyer. Accurate and detailed records are essential in navigating complex medical litigation, ensuring that all aspects of patient care are meticulously examined. Every interaction, diagnosis, treatment plan, and outcome should be diligently documented to provide a clear narrative of events.
For instance, in cases involving slip and fall injuries in an ER setting, proper documentation can highlight crucial details like the sequence of events, witness accounts, and existing medical conditions. These records are invaluable when constructing a solid case strategy, as they help legal professionals identify potential negligence or breaches of standard care procedures.
